ZIP code 20776 is located in Harwood, Maryland, within Anne Arundel County. It covers approximately 21.62 square miles and serves a population of 2,966 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Eastern (ET) timezone, served by area code 443/667/410.

About ZIP code 20776

The housing stock consists of predominantly single-family detached homes. Most homes were built in the 1980s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$584,700. Owner-occupancy is high at 94%, well above the national average.

The gap between median ($118,092) and mean household income suggests income inequality — a small number of higher earners pull the average up. The poverty rate of 4% is below the national average. 52%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.

The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. An above-average commute of 36 minutes suggests many residents work outside the immediate area.

Educational attainment is near the national average, with 40% of residents holding a bachelor's degree or higher.

Overall, ZIP code 20776 reflects a community defined by high homeownership and a significant Social Security-dependent population.
